Why it costs what it costs
A printed polo takes a finished blank and puts a logo on the chest. This one is printed as flat panels and then cut and sewn, so the pattern carries over the shoulder and around the placket instead of stopping at a rectangle. Made after you order it, so nothing here is priced to cover unsold stock.
This is the Signature build: ribbed collar, short placket, straight hem. The Royal Navy polo is a different make — taped neck and shoulders, quarter-turned so there is no centre crease. Neither is the better shirt; they are two collars for two kinds of day.
Gold shields, each marked with an oxblood cross, sit in a gold lattice on charcoal, with JOSHUA 1:9 in gold small caps set into the repeat. There is no logo on the chest. The hem is straight rather than curved, which is a decision about where the pattern ends: a curved tail is cut to be tucked, and a tucked shirt loses the bottom of the repeat inside a waistband. This one is finished to be left out, with the panel whole.
